Transaction ff177a8ae8e185b45933326d8fc98914954fbcd3eac55dddc1263e1a0677e825
1 Input
1 Output
-
ff177a8ae8e185b45933326d8fc98914954fbcd3eac55dddc1263e1a0677e825:0
- value
- 3312555
- script pubkey
- OP_0 OP_PUSHBYTES_20 e1f77e70cfda6244c1f9a9fb269019819d4eefc2
- address
- bc1qu8mhuux0mf3yfs0e48ajdyqesxw5am7zxtpn3c